M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about this impressive new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
discusses
subjects
relevant to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
advances in
distance learning technology have provided the means for
people
in every nation on earth
to be participants in online courses.
These MOOC classes are
typically free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are numerous
subjects that
technology-enhanced learning institutions
are having to attend to
more than ever because learning technology is
improving so fast.
How can institutions
guarantee that
the training provided by these
massively open online courses is
all right?
How can organizations
be assured that
lecturers are properly credentialed
to teach MOOC classes?
What business models are being used by
organizations like
Princeton University to conduct these massive open online courses?
What teaching practices and innovative assessment strategies are optimal?
How can we
manage
poor
motivation and high
learner dropout rates?
As technology-enhanced learning becomes more
commonplace there is a
developing
desideratum
to be aware of how
MOOC courses are being conducted.
Public servants
and lots of other
participants
want
to better understand
the outcomes of these
fascinating new open education
endeavours.
Scholars want
to better understand how
these massively open online courses
can be improved.
In response to this
increasing
desire for
details
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World
offers a critical analysis of
massively open online courses and other open education topics.
This scholarly new book
also talks about the
controversies associated with
these online MOOCs and open educational resources.
